Latest situation in the Gaza Strip
➡️ Based on the latest videos & info from Gaza City, Israeli forces have withdrawn from Beit Hanoun & most of Beit Lahia area. But clashes continue in Jabalia & Sheikh Radwan areas. Also, the Israelis have retreated from some places in Shujaiyah.
➡️ In the central axis, during the last four days, Israeli forces have entered the Gaza Strip from the south of Bureij. Also, Israeli forces have taken control of most of al-Maghraqa and advanced in Juhr al-Dik. Now most of clashes are concentrated around Bureij & Nuseirat.
➡️ In the southern axis, the clashes continue in the city of Khan Yunis and no specific changes have been made in the lines of control. If new information is obtained, this map will be updated or corrected.
➡️ During the past few days, Israeli forces entered the Gaza Strip from two new axes from the south of Jabalia and reached the Israeli forces west of Jabalia camp and tightened the siege of Jabalia camp.
